您好,  [请登录] [QQ登录]  [支付宝登录[免费注册]

商品分类

分享到: 百度搜藏 搜狐微博 新浪微博 腾讯微博 QQ收藏 人人网 Facebook Twitter

针对DSP处理惩罚器的应用计划的体系存储器

发布日期:2011-04-23

    在利用数字信号处理惩罚器(DSP)的内嵌式计划中,DSP是从它内部的高速存储器中把应用步伐取出来来实行。这个存储器通常是SRAM。然而,SRAM属於易失性存储器,以是必要用一只放在表面的非易失性存储器存放应用步伐,在接通电源时,并在以後调用步伐时,把应用步伐装到内部的SRAM中。 

    DSP体系存储器(DSM)是针对利用DSP嵌入式计划而推出的体系存储器办理方案,此中集成了体系内可编程的闪速存储器、可编程逻辑、通用I/O端口。DSP体系存储器与平凡的闪速存储器差别,它不但是起“引导步伐”存储器的作用,与平凡的闪速存储器件相比,它上升了一个台阶。本文扼要先容DSM存储器的成果和开辟东西。 

    在利用数字信号处理惩罚器(DSP)的内嵌式计划中,DSP是从它内部的高速存储器中把应用步伐取出来来实行。这个存储器通常是SRAM。然而,SRAM属於易失性存储器,以是必要用一只放在表面的非易失性存储器存放应用步伐,在接通电源时,并在以後调用步伐时,把应用步伐装到内部的SRAM中。 

    DSP体系存储器(DSM)是针对利用DSP嵌入式计划而推出的体系存储器办理方案,此中集成了体系内可编程的闪速存储器、可编程逻辑、通用I/O端口。DSP体系存储器与平凡的闪速存储器差别,它不但是起“引导步伐”存储器的作用,与平凡的闪速存储器件相比,它上升了一个台阶。 

    DSP体系存储器用起来既大略又机动,它为体系计划职员提供了一个一揽子的体系存储器办理方案。这个办理方案可以或许有效地收缩产品上市时间,并低落整个体系的本钱。DSM2180F3是针对Analog Devices 的ADSP218x系列16位数字信号处理惩罚器而计划的。这个高集成度的闪速存储器办理方案是意法半导体和Analog Devices两家公司相助获取的新结果。要是DSP体系利用这个办理方案,在制造时期,可以先把器件装到电路板上,然後通过JTAG很快地举行体系内编程,也可以在应用现埸由DSP本身高服从地在现场举行编程。这个器件中包括可编程逻辑电路,有更多的I/O,它们都集成在一块芯片上。 

    JTAG ISP 

    完全空缺的DSM2180F3器件在焊接到电路板上之後10秒至20秒,就可以对它编程,不必要DSP参加,同样也不必要插座,标号大概预先编程好的器件。意法半导体的FlashLINK JTAG ISP编程器可以或许与任意计算机大概条记本计算机都共同利用。可以或许有效地低落工程开辟时间,因而可以节流本钱,又进一步低落了制造的本钱。 

    在平凡的制造进程中有很多道工序,此中包括:预测每一种型号整机产品的数量,预先编程,在逻辑器件和闪速存储器上加标记,组装电路板以及测试(此中包括装有预先颠末编程的器件的插座),然後运送给客户大概存放到堆栈中。然而,利用JTAG ISP,可以先把全部的电路板都制造出来,此中没有插座,也不必专门举行配置。编程是在生产线的最後阶段举行的,先是测试步伐,然後是应用步伐以餍足客户的请求。不必要预测整机产品的数量,也不必要存货。在最後一刻还可以修改,并且很容易做到。 

    也可以用JTAG ISP的要领举行现埸更新,不必把把产品拆卸下来,不必把存储器和逻辑器件拿下来,调换新的。 

    16个I/O引脚 

    在DSP中,I/O引脚的数量一样平常是不敷的。ASP-218x最多只有11个I/O。DSM2180F3增长了16个I/O引脚。因此可以控制更多的外围部件,同时不必要增长芯片,也不必别的用一只微控制器来处理惩罚I/O。这些I/O很机动,可以由DSP步伐来控制,也可以直接由PLD逻辑电路来控制。 

    通用PLD 

    DSM存储器中有两种PLD:通用PLD和CPLD。利用DSM2180F3中的通用PLD,可以计划状态机、选片成果、连接逻辑、计数器、延时器等等。CPLD有16个输入宏单位和16个输出宏单位,可以用它们实现体系逻辑成果,比方计数器、移位寄存器,大概对进到芯片的信号举行取样,大概去失信号(比方噪杂的键盘输入)中的抖动大概反跳。由於芯片上有PLD,就不必利用那些接在表面的小型逻辑器件,并且可以代替PLD(22V10)、PAL(20L8)、74XX系列逻辑器件(74HC374)等芯片。用PSDsoft Express软件开辟东西,只要举行点击就可以把逻辑成果输入进去,着实是很大略。PSDsoft Express软件可以从本公司的网站免费得到。 

    访问闪速存储器的两个要领 

    在加上电源之後以及在其他的时间,DSP是由表面的引导存储器、用字节直接存储器存取,简称BDMA(Byte Direct Memory Access)要领把数据装到内部的SRAM中。BDMA很快地读取外部闪速存储器很大文件段中的数据,并把它们写到SRAM中。就把数据写到闪速存储器而言,BDMA并不是服从最好的要领。由于闪速存储是一次写入一个字节,而不是把整块数据写进去。除了BDMA之外,DSM2180F3还可以用别的一种要领举行访问。闪速存储器可以作为外部数据包围存储器(Data Overlay Memory)来访问,一次一个字节,对於闪速存储器的编程,这是很美满的。用这个要领,DSP可以或许很快地从利用BDMA的闪速存储器读取大块的代码大概数据。并且也可以高服从地把数据写到作为外部数据包围存储器的闪速存储器中去。要是用标准的商用闪速存储器,则必要别的的逻辑电路,并且要花大力大举气来作计划才华到达同样的机动性。 

    掩护内容的寂静 

    有两个要领可以用来掩护存储器中内容的寂静。一个是用一个寂静位来掩护,另一个要领是段掩护的要领。 

    寂静位黑白易失可编程位,它堵塞器件编程器和读取器对存储器的访问,掩护器件防备未经授权而举行读出以及复制闪速存储器的内容,大概对闪速存储器的内容和PLD公式举行编程。只有在擦除了整个芯片,寂静位才会失去掩护作用。但是在此以後可以重新编程。DSP总是可以访问闪速存储器,纵然是器件己担当到掩护。别的,闪速存储器有8个区段,每个区段可以分别地掩护起来防备不测地举行写入。对於掩护引导步伐,这是很抱负的。 

    功耗小 

    闪速存储器是用零功率技能制造的,在两次访问之间的时间里,它主动地把电流低落到待机电流。PLD也属於零功率器件,此中的功率办理单位可以或许控制PLD的速率因而低落斲丧的电流。在运行时,PLD中的功率办理单位是由DSP来控制的。事变电压为5V的器件在待机时的电流只有75μA;而事变电压为3V的器件在待机时的电流为25μA,因而对於用电池供电的应用,这是很抱负的。 

    开辟东西 

    软件开辟东西PSDsoft Express的利用是很大略的,只要用点击就可以举行配置和逻辑计划。PSDsoft Express是免费提供的,可以从利用阐明书CD盘得到。 

    FlashLINK是一种JTAG ISP编程器,它接到计算机上的并行端口上,价格是59美元。2001年9月开始提供评价板,价格是99美元。全部的开辟东西,利用阐明书以及应用文章可以从本公司的网站得到,URL:www.st.com/psd 

    DSM2180F3是意法半导体公司和Analog Devices公司相助的结果。这项产品是存储器技能新盼望的代表,它的成果高出了现有的商用存储器。DSM2180F3的优秀成果,加上它的价格低,开辟东西容易利用,对於利用ADSP-218x系列的DSP计划,它是抱负的体系存储器办理方案。